Due to the fact that landscape design is a seasonal service in numerous regions, there is a higher need for landscape layout work in spring and summertime. Rates might be greater when developers are busiest. One prospective means for home owners to conserve cash is to start collaborating with a landscape designer in their off-season, such as the middle of winter.
The dirt makeup of a backyard is a crucial variable in the style and maintenance of landscape design. The kind of soil, in addition to pH levels, can affect which plants the designer chooses for the plan and the plants' capacity to prosper. Landscape developers commonly evaluate the soil for acidity degree, nutrients, and drainage during a website visit.

When developing a domestic landscape, the most crucial step is to place a strategy on paper. Creating a plan of attack will certainly save you time and money and is extra likely to lead to an effective design. A master strategy is created via the 'style procedure': a step-by-step approach that thinks about the ecological problems, your desires, and the elements and concepts of layout.
The five steps of the design process include: 1) performing a website stock and evaluation, 2) establishing your needs, 3) creating useful representations, 4) developing theoretical design plans, and 5) drawing a final design strategy. The initial 3 actions establish the aesthetic, functional, and horticultural needs for the layout. The last 2 steps then apply those requirements to the development of the final landscape strategy.
